C. Trozzi et al., SPEED FREQUENCY-DISTRIBUTION IN AIR-POLLUTANTS EMISSIONS ESTIMATE FROM ROAD TRAFFIC, Science of the total environment, 190, 1996, pp. 181-185
The work discusses the aspects linked to the speed in the application
of the CORINAIR methodology to urban areas. In particular, the introdu
ction of a speed frequency distribution (in thirteen classes with rang
e 10 km/h) by vehicle category is discussed. A study on sensitivity fi
nalized to the analysis of the influence of speed on the emissions is
presented. Many cases are examined in which, keeping the average speed
constant, a different speed distribution is introduced. The estimates
obtained through the simulations are compared with those obtained usi
ng a single average speed. The result is that a deeper knowledge of dr
iving characteristics and speeds is essential to understand means of t
he estimates for those pollutants whose emission dependence on speed i
s strongly non-linear.
